JUSTICE AND PRISONS DEPARTMENT

NOTE.—Unless indicated otherwise, the salaries shown are deemed to include any payment hitherto or at present made by way of allowance for special services or duties as Registrar of Births, Deaths, and Marriages, Registrar of Electors, Clerk of Licensing Committee, Official Assignee, Clerk of Awards, or of fees on execution of Sheriff’s writs.

REFERENCES: JUSTICE—* Also scale lodging-allowance. † Salary includes £25 per annum as Inspector of Factories. ‡ Also Clerk of Licensing Committee (or Committees). ¶ To be considered for regrading after one year on present maximum. ‡‡ Subject to passing Departmental Examination within two years of resuming civilian duties. Salary not to advance beyond C, V status until examination is passed. ± On leave without pay. § Grading personal to officer. (a) Also Registrar of Electors. (b) Also Returning Officer. (c) Also Registrar of Births, Deaths, and Marriages. (d) Has passed all subjects of Law Professional Examination. (e) Also free quarters. (f) Salary includes remuneration as: J. W. Bain, Secretary of Law Revision Committee; O. S. Harvey, Clerk of Licensing Committee and Office-cleaner. (h) Also annual allowance as shown as Maintenance Officer. (i) Also annual allowance as shown as Probation Officer. (j) Also annual allowance as shown as Inspector of Factories. (n) Also annual allowance as shown in lieu of free fuel and light. (o) Salary includes payment as Maintenance Officer. (p) Also annual allowance of £18 as Office-cleaner, £25 as Maintenance Officer, and £30 special. △ On loan to another Department: iv, Cook Islands Administration, New Zealand salary £760 per annum from 1/4/47; v, Rehabilitation; ix, Scientific and Industrial Research. ¶ Receives annual special and/or higher duties allowance as shown as at 1/4/47. + Regrading adjustment allowance. λ Does not contribute to Superannuation Fund.
